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ations For Small Digital Cameras
When choosing a compact video camera, consider how you’ll use it most often, who will be using it, and where you’ll shoot. The following factors help compare models and align features with real-world needs.
- Video resolution and frames per second: 4K offers sharper detail, but 1080p can be sufficient for social sharing and casual use. Look for 60fps or higher if you plan to shoot action or fast motion.
- Photo resolution: Higher MP counts can capture detailed stills, but sensor size and processing matter as well. For most casual shooters, 24–50MP stills are more than adequate.
- Autofocus and image stabilization: Reliable autofocus and optical or digital stabilization reduce blur during moving shots. Check if anti-shake features are built-in.
- Screen type and angles: A flip or touch screen helps with self-recording and creative angles. Consider 180° or 270° tilting screens for vlogging.
- Storage and battery life: Many cameras come with a microSD card and extra batteries. If you shoot a lot on trips, prioritize extended battery life and easy card expansion.
- Portability and weight: If you want a true pocket camera, prioritize lighter frames and smaller footprints, even if it means trading some raw power.
- Bundled accessories: Bundles with memory cards, tripods, mics, and extra batteries can be cost-effective and ready-to-shoot out of the box.
- Ease of use: For beginners and kids, intuitive menus, quick-start guides, and simple controls reduce the learning curve and improve the shooting experience.
- Connectivity: Some models offer webcam mode, Wi-Fi or Bluetooth for quick sharing or live streaming. Consider your workflow needs.
- Durability and warranty: A durable build and responsive customer support help with long-term satisfaction, especially for travel and family use.
